Hi Group,
I performed a search, but I didn't see a thread matching this inquiry. I've decided to purchase a Timney trigger for my AR-15, which currently has a 6 pound stock trigger. I'm wonfdering which trigger weight would be right. My choices are 3, 4 or 4.5 lb. triggers. My initial thought is that a 4 pound trigger would be just right. Although tempting, I'm thinking that a 3 pound trigger weight would be too light on a defensive rifle? I've always shot stock triggers so I wanted to get some of your expertise. I would appreciate any feedback and/ or thoughts/ opinions. Thanks! |
|
For a defensive rifle, save your money and send your trigger group off to Bill Springfield. For $35 he'll give a creep free 4# trigger that is very crisp.
This is coming from someone who has both a Timney trigger for my precision AR, and one of Bill's triggers in my defensive rifle. |
